Causes of Condom Damage
Why are condoms torn? This question is asked of couples who have had such an incident. The following are the most likely causes of this phenomenon. Let us consider in more detail in which cases a condom breaks.
- Expiration of products. When buying condoms, always pay attention to the expiration date indicated on the package.
- Wrong storage conditions. In addition to the basic rules, such as preventing overcooling and overheating, try to prevent it from touching other objects in the bag that could damage it. Do not carry the protective equipment in the back pockets, as this may result in mechanical damage and lead to rupture of the latex.
- Incorrect donning. Excessive stretching, or, conversely, wrinkling, also increases the chances of undesirable consequences.
- Marriage in production. If you use the products of little-known companies, then a situation is possible in which the product will initially be defective. To protect yourself from such surprises, do not save on protection, choose well-known brands and purchase condoms at the pharmacy. The world's leading manufacturers are very careful about testing their products, and can guarantee quality.
- Choosing the wrong size. Sometimes men give wishful thinking and purchase larger condoms than required. As a result, the latex product does not fit snugly against the genitals.
- Lack of lubricant. In the case when a woman does not stand out lubricant in sufficient quantities, it is necessary to use a lubricant. Use water-based lubricants, as fats destroy the latex structure and reduce protection by 90 percent.
- Using two condoms at the same time is one of the reasons why condoms break. Usually this method is used by men suffering from premature ejaculation. With the help of double protection, they seek to reduce the sensitivity of the penis and prolong the love affair. But in reality, it doesnβt turn out quite like that, condoms rub against each other and are equally damaged.
- Long intercourse. Too long a sexual act is not always good. This phenomenon is called retard ejaculation. Manufacturers of protective equipment strongly recommend changing a condom if sexual intercourse lasts more than an hour and a half.
- Wrong opening of packaging. Many people in a fit of passion open the packaging with their teeth. This is not a good idea, as the product itself can be damaged with your teeth.
- Each condom can be used for one sexual intercourse, after which it needs to be changed to a new one.
Why condoms break during intercourse
The main reasons why condoms are torn are related to non-compliance with the rules for their use. And although during testing they are stretched, poured water, imitate sexual intercourse, but it is impossible to predict all human actions.
Why does a condom break during sex? The main reason is too active intercourse. Even if you did everything right, but your passion and potential are very great, there is some possibility of damage to the latex product.

Interesting facts about condom use
A men's magazine conducted a survey in which 100 men participated. He allowed to identify the most common mistakes associated with condoms.
- A quarter of the respondents confuse the inside and the outside, and when they come to their senses, they put it on correctly. But on the outside, there may be a pre-ejaculant that contains sperm.
- More than half of the men admitted that they did not use additional lubricant, although they knew that the native condom lubricant was not enough for long.
- 80% of respondents do not check condoms before use for damage and shelf life.
- 30% admitted that they were in no hurry to leave their partner after an orgasm. The problem is that the penis is reduced in size, and there is a space between it and the latex product.
- Only 25% of respondents unfold a condom before putting it on.
Some of these data answer the question of why condoms are torn during intercourse.
